Change the air filters in your air conditioner

Air filters in the central air conditioning system have an important role to play in controlling indoor pollution. All home air conditioning units have air filters that clean the pollutants and dust in the air thrown out by the unit. Looking after the air filter is important and hence should be taken seriously. The ideal thing to do is to change the filter every month when the air conditioning and heating unit is in operation. It would do a world of good if you make sure that all the filters in your residential air conditioner units are changed periodically. Remember that some systems may have multiple filters or different types of filters within them. Dirty air filters can increase your operating costs and deliver reduced cooling.
